Kenya Veterinary Board is a State Corporation established under the Veterinary Surgeon and Veterinary Paraprofessionals (VSVP) Act No.29 of 2011.
The Board is mandated to exercise general supervision and control over the training, business, practice and employment of Veterinary Surgeons and Veterinary Paraprofessionals in Kenya and advice the Government in all aspects thereof.

3. Job title: Manager Finance Human Resource and Administration
Job grade: KVB 2
No of posts: 1
REF: KVB/MFHRA/3/2020
Terms of service: 3 year contract renewable subject to satisfactory performance.
The monthly remuneration will include Kshs -Basic salary: 134, 673, House allowance: 60,000, Commuter allowance: 20,000, Extraneous allowance: 30,000, Entertainment 32,500
An officer at this level will be responsible to the Secretary/Chief Executive Officer. The Manager Finance, Human Resource and Administration will oversee the management of the Finance and Accounts, Human Resource and Administration,
Information and Communication Technology and Corporate Communication functions of the Board.
Key Responsibilities:
i. Oversee the management of Finance and Accounts, Human Resource and Administration, Corporate Communications and Information Communication Technology management in the Board;
ii. Formulate, interpret and implementation of Finance and Accounts, human resource, corporate communications and information communication technology policies, strategies, and programmes;
iii. Responsible for the prudent management and utilization of all the resources under the above departments;
iv. Responsible for the development of a master strategy and business continuity management of the Directorate;
v. Responsible for the implementation of the Board's resolutions on matters affecting the departments under his or her oversight role;
vi. Responsible for the consolidation of the departmental procurement plans and budgets;
vii. Responsible for team work and collaboration among the various departments under his or her supervision;
viii. Coordinating the preparation of respective board papers for Finance and Human Resource Board committees;
ix. Ensuring efficient, effective, professional and sustainable human resource and administrative systems within the Board; and
x. Responsible for the development and implementation of the strategies of the respective Departments.
Requirement for appointment
For appointment to this grade, a candidate must-:
i. Have a Minimum of twelve (12) years relevant work experience with at least five (5) in a management Position;
ii. Have Bachelor's Degree in any of the following: Commerce, Accounting, Business Administration, Finance or equivalent qualification from a recognized institution;
iii. Have Master's Degree in any of the following: Commerce, Accounting, Business Administration or equivalent qualification from a recognized institution;
iv. Be a member of a relevant professional body;
v. Certificate in a Management Course lasting not less than four (4) weeks from a recognized institution;
vi. Be proficient in computer applications;
vii. Fulfill the requirements of Chapter Six of the Constitution; and
viii. Demonstrate competence in work performance.

Ethics and integrity
Shortlisted candidates shall be expected to prove their compliance with chapter 6 of the Constitution of Kenya 2010 by obtaining and presenting clearance/compliance certificates from the following organization during interview.
1. Kenya Revenue Authority KRA)
2. Higher Educations Loans Board (HELB)
3. Ethics and Anti-Corruption Commission (EACC)
4. Directorate of Criminal Investigations (DCI)
5. Credit Reference Bureau (CRB)
